Roland Gesthuizen is a STEM Method Lecturer at Monash University, and DLTV Journal editor. His teaching interests span Science, Digitech and STEM Education. Roland has grounded his teaching practice in his professional experience as a research scientist with ICI Australia (Orica). As an Internet pioneer, he was the first to help design and build an Australian public utility website and an EarthDial used with the NASA Mars Rovers for the Planetary Society. Roland’s work has been recognised with an ACCE Educator of the Year Award and ISTE Making IT happen award. As a PhD candidate, his current research is exploring inspiration and the conative domain within STEM Education.
